How do they match: Plumbers, Pipefitters, and Steamfitters

  • Steam Trap Worker

  • Operate motorized pumps to remove water from flooded manholes, basements, or facility floors.
  • Cut openings in structures to accommodate pipes or pipe fittings, using hand or power tools.
  • Inspect work sites for obstructions or holes that could cause structural weakness.
  • Keep records of work assignments.
  • Maintain or repair plumbing by replacing defective washers, replacing or mending broken pipes, or opening clogged drains.
  • Review blueprints, building codes, or specifications to determine work details or procedures.
